Carlota’s smartphone contains 500 megabytes of data. She uses 300 megabytes for applications and the rest for music. If each son

g takes an average of 4 megabytes, which equations can be used to find the number of songs on Carlota’s smartphone? Select all that apply. A. 500−300=4n B. 500+300=4n C. 4n+300=500 D. 300−4n=500
Mathematics
1 answer:
Masja [62]2 years ago
7 0

Answer: A:500-300=4n and C:4n+300=500
